Great answer from Poonam Sharma. There is an easier way to see the case: sand and lava are roughly of the same composition, mainly silicates. So sand will melt into lava, as much as water ice will melt into liquid water. read more

The temperature of lava when it is first ejected from a volcanic vent can vary between 700 and 1,200 degrees C (1,300 to 2,200 F). The melting point of sand, which is predominantly silicon dioxide, is incredibly high requiring a temperature of (1,610 °C). The boiling point of SiO2 is (2,230 °C). read more
